Description
A Journey In Citizenship and The Tough Questions is a uniquely designed Discussion Guide and companion to the Master Publication, The Conscious Citizen: The Tough Questions The Average American Should Be Asking.
As a Discussion Guide, this publication is intended to be used by those who are reading or have read the Master, with the goal of benefiting further from the insights and lessons gained on how to more effectively contribute as Conscious Citizens within America's Democratic Republic. The benefits are best gained by first reading the Master Publication.
Then, you should read and make notes in the Discussion Guide of any changes in your previous perspective on "how big a problem" is each of the sixteen topic areas presented following your experience of the reading of The Conscious Citizen. Another approach would be to perform this exercise as a part of a neighborhood gathering or a small, facilitated group during a sponsored training session.
In either approach, you should remember that the objective is a review of the Tough Questions and a discussion of the critical thinking process used by the protagonists, Paul and Paulette, in The Conscious Citizen, as they arrived at their survey responses.
The objective is not to seek any form of consensus, if you are in a group setting. It's all about understanding the thought process. The sixteen topic areas presented in the Discussion Guide were first determined by the Pew Research Center, a well-respected and national Think Tank, as America's major "problems" in July 2024, a few months before the U.S. Presidential Election. Person
Earl is an accomplished corporate executive, leadership development coach, lecturer, and author. He has held senior technical and leadership positions within Fortune 100, Mid-market and Venture companies including Honeywell, Inc., Motorola, Inc., The Reynolds and Reynolds Company and Wells Fargo Bank. He is the former President, COO and CEO of the high-tech start-up, MedContrax, Inc. Earl earned a Bachelor of Science degree in Electrical Engineering, with honors, from Tennessee State University. He graduated from Arizona State University with a Master of Science degree in Engineering.He is a former Adjunct Professor of Management at the Keller Graduate School of Management of DeVry University. He has completed graduate studies at Stanford University's Graduate School of Business, the Sloan School of Management at MIT and the Center for Creative Leadership. Earl is the author of 14 published books and over 100 published articles.
